Re: Soul With a Capital 'S'
Yep, it was actually moderately-heavily-promoted leading up to the second game. It was three songs in particular:
- "Soul with a Capital S"
- "Only So Much Oil in the Ground"
- "Soul Vaccination"
It was also more Kenji Yamamoto arrangements of said songs than it was Tower of Power just performing the songs themselves. They're definitely minor adaptations of the songs than a straight-up performance of them.
It's one of the few "NOT actually plagiarism" examples!
